要将Visual Studio项目从使用宽字符串转换为普通字符串,请按照以下步骤操作:
例如,如果您的代码中有以下宽字符串:
std::wstring wideString = L"Hello, world!";
您可以将其转换为普通字符串,如下所示:
std::string normalString = std::string(wideString.begin(), wideString.end());
这将创建一个新的普通字符串,其中包含与宽字符串相同的字符。
请注意,这种转换可能会导致数据丢失,因为某些宽字符可能无法转换为普通字符。因此,在执行此操作时,请确保您的代码可以处理可能的数据丢失。
领取专属 10元无门槛券
手把手带您无忧上云